Major change to Taupō recycling

The Team from Neighbourly.co.nz

At the beginning of this year, China stopped accepting plastic waste. As a result, Taupō District Council will no longer be taking plastics with the code 3-7. This will begin on October 1. Contractors will put a message in the bin if you have recycled 3-7 plastics. Cans, bottles and some plastics will still be accepted, but the rest - such as yoghurt pottles, ice cream containers, shampoo bottles - will be considered rubbish.

These codes - 3-7 plastics - have been recyclable since 2006, so Taupō residents had become used to putting these plastics into the recycle bin. That process had seen them able to divert about 34 million containers from landfill.

Taupō District Council say, "Look at the plastic to find the triangle with the number on it. We will accept 1-2 plastics, 3-7 will need to go into a refuse bag. People need to think about what they purchase, consumers can drive the change in the market, we want you to go in and think about alternatives."
